
The Peninsula of Mani
The peninsula of Mani is located in the middle of the three peninsulas of the South of Peloponnese where the Ionian Sea meets with the Aegean Sea. More than 96 traditional villages with their houses and stone towers, impressive caves, Byzantine churches, beautiful beaches and local cuisine make Mani a unique destination to go by car all year round.

Areopoli
A walk through the cobbled streets with their tower houses is like traveling in the past. The Church of Taxiarhes on the southern side of Plateia 17 Martiou, the Towers of Kapetanakos, Mparelakou and Pikoula are some of the main sights in Areopoli… Enjoy your stay in traditional houses and taste the local food in their typical taverns.
Limeni
Limeni is a magical place! it is a small bay with deep blue waters and stone houses, literally built hanging from the rocky hillside. This small village that formerly belonged to the Mavromichali family today is considered one of the most picturesque places in Greece and is known for its fish taverns and lovely views at sunset.
Itylo
Built on a hill overlooking the bay, Itylo is a town steeped in history. According to Homer during the Mycenaean period, this city belonged to the Kingdom of Menelaus and took part in the war of Troy. Today the area is a perfect destination to relax.
